Description
American Traveler is seeking a Respiratory Therapist for a Level III NICU position requiring 2+ years of NICU experience and open to first-time travelers.
Details
- Work in a Level III NICU at a regional trauma center
- Also requires skill and experience to work in a Level II regional trauma center setting
- Night shift schedule with 3x12-hour shifts from 7:00 PM to 7:00 AM
- Weekend work required every other weekend per CBA
- May float between departments internally and must be flexible
- Patient ratios dependent on hospital acuity
- No on-call requirements
- Uses Epic charting system
Requirements
- Minimum 2 years of experience required in a Level III or IV NICU
- Washington state RRT license required in hand at time of submission (license required if applicable)
- Current certifications required: BLS, ACLS, NRP, PALS, and CRT or RRT
- Epic EMR experience required
- Trauma Level I and Level II experience preferred
- Experience with high frequency jet ventilator, oscillating ventilator, and pressure/volume ventilator preferred
- Experience with direct neonatal intubation and umbilical blood gases preferred
- Must be able to work independently and autonomously within a Level III NICU
- Two supervisory references required covering 1 year of employment within the last 3 years
Additional Information
- First-time travelers will be considered for this position
- Provide respiratory care to neonatal patients including high-risk delivery support and ventilator management
- All staff, including full-time employees, are considered variable staff for the unit
- Exact shift assignment (day or night) is typically confirmed one to two weeks in advance
- Must commit to working 3 of the 5 major holidays (Thanksgiving, Christmas Eve, Christmas Day, New Year's Eve, New Year's Day)
- All RTO and specific scheduling requests must be submitted upfront during the application process
- Travelers may be expected to float between sister facilities near the contracted location
- Former permanent staff must wait at least 3 months before returning as a traveler and cannot be within 50 miles of the facility
- Local candidates accepted at a lower bill rate
- Local radius rule of 50 miles applies

About Richland, WA
As a travel nurse in Richland, WA here's what you should know:- The cost of living in Richland, WA is slightly higher than the national average, with housing costs being the main contributing factor.
- However, wages generally match up with the cost of living in this area.
- Richland experiences hot summers with average highs of 87°F and lows of 59°F, while winters are cold with average highs of 41°F and lows of 26°F.
- Short term rentals and furnished housing options are available in Richland, and they are relatively easy to find due to the city's proximity to the Hanford Site and the Pacific Northwest National Laboratory.
- Richland is relatively car-friendly, with a well-maintained road network.
- Public transportation options are available, including bus services operated by Ben Franklin Transit.
- The population of Richland is diverse, with a mix of age groups.
- Common health issues in the area include allergies, asthma, and seasonal flu.
- Richland has a growing community of travel nurses due to the presence of healthcare facilities.
- Richland offers a variety of dining options, including local restaurants serving Pacific Northwest cuisine.
- The city has a thriving arts and music scene, with events and performances held at venues like the Richland Players Theater.
- Outdoor enthusiasts can enjoy activities such as hiking, biking, and water sports along the Columbia River.
